Forced Distribution Method
A performance evaluation system where employees are ranked in accordance with a predetermined distribution curve, such as a bell curve, forcing managers to differentiate between high, medium, and low performers.
Multiperson Comparison
An appraisal method that evaluates and compares the performance of employees against each other to establish rankings.
Performance Classifications
The categorization of employee or organizational performance levels, typically used to assess, compare, and manage productivity and outcomes.
Merit Pay System
A compensation strategy that rewards employees based on their performance, as assessed through appraisals or achievements.
